An octagonal steel belt buckle with clipped corners, featuring decorative silver inlay applied using the koftgari technique. The reverse is fitted with a soldered steel belt loop and a single attachment hook. The calligraphic design is centred around a lobed diamond-shaped cartouche containing the Arabic phrase Tawakkaltu ala Allah (I have put my trust in God). This central motif is surrounded by a wide border of interlocking script which begins at the top with the Basmala: Bismillah al-Rahman al-Rahim (In the name of God, the Most Gracious, the Most Merciful).

L: 11cm
